Additionally, it takes place in appreciable quantity in saline lakes and salt pans and is a crucial constituent of cap rock, an anhydrite-gypsum rock forming a masking on salt domes, as in Texas and Louisiana.
Gypsum are available in hydrothermal veins, which happen to be fractures in rocks stuffed with mineral-abundant fluids that originate from deep inside the Earth's crust.
From desert evaporite basins to deep marine environments and volcanic regions, gypsum forms below a wide number of situations that make it a crucial indicator of environmental change.

Gypsum plaster is actually a white cementing product made by partial or full dehydration on the mineral gypsum, frequently with special retarders or hardeners additional. Applied inside a plastic point out (with drinking water), it sets and hardens by chemical recombination on the gypsum with water.
